Galleria Taal: The First Camera Museum in the Philippines
Known as the Heritage town of the South, Taal, Batangas will make you travel back in time with its various antiquarian shops and ancestral houses in every corner of the streets. Each turn guarantees fascination as it will make you look into the town in retrospect. The town boasts open museums and galleries with captivating antediluvian trappings which are much more interesting on the inside. Among the must-sees is that of the Philippine’s very first Camera Museum at the heart of the town, the Galleria Taal. Cotivas Island, Caramoan, Camarines Sur
Caramoan was once a home to the contestants of a global reality show, Survivor. Right there and then, a lot of travelers have been eyeing the group of islands rich in grainy to fine white sand beaches, lagoons, caves, limestone cliffs and formations and more that this small town boasts. Caramoan is actually a small quiet town in the province of Camarines Sur of the Bicol Region. It is a thirteen to fourteen-hour drive from Manila. A Travel Guide to Mt. Daraitan with Tinipak River Side Trip
The province of Rizal is blessed to be surrounded with the mountainous terrain of Sierra Madre. Situated at Southern Luzon, part of Region IV-A CALABARZON, its geographical location has been quite an advantage to the travelers, mountaineers and recreational hikers most especially from the Metro since it is just an hour or two away from the city’s hustle; hence, making a surge of them pay the province’s wonders a visit on weekends.
